Canada’s Fastest Half

The fast First Half 21.1KM route starts and ends near Yaletown Roundhouse Community Centre. The Finish Line awaits you near Pacific Blvd and Drake St. The course is marked at every kilometre and at halfway, and you’ll have course marshals and pacers to guide you. This route is accurately measured and certified.

Scenic Course

A waterfront out-and-back course, the ‘First Half’ Half Marathon is a scenic, 21.1KM route that takes place in Downtown Vancouver. Kicking off near the Roundhouse Community Centre, the First Half continues out past Sunset Beach, along the Seawall. For the virtual race, you’re asked to please find your own pedestrian friendly route.

WATER Stations : Oncourse

Multiple water stations will be available oncourse for the live in-person event. Nuun Electrolyte will be at each station, plus Xact Nutrition will be at the station near the 12.5KM mark. Each volunteer station will also include water. Stations and elevation charts are included in the maps for reference.

First Half Course Description

The First Half starts at 8:30am and finishes at 11:30am with approximately 2,500 runners expected out on the course. The race begins in front of the Roundhouse Community Centre on Pacific Boulevard between Davie and Drake Street at 8:30am.

Start the race heading eastbound on Pacific Boulevard. Left turn onto Pat Queen Way, followed by another left onto Expo Blvd, sends runners around the Stadium and back onto Pacific Boulevard. Proceed West on Pacific Boulevard, crossing the Start Line in the opposite direction, before turning left under the Granville Street Bridge and running down to Beach Avenue.

Continue along Beach Ave to the Aquatic Centre, through the Aquatic Centre parking lot, onto the Seawall and past English Bay Beach. Exit the Seawall and head up the short hill to Stanley Park Drive. Staying on the path, not the roadway, descend the short hill onto the Ceperley Park bicycle path and through the bike tunnel towards Lost Lagoon.

The course continues along the bike path around the southside of Lost Lagoon and underneath Georgia St via the Chilco Underpass. At the Devonian Park Circle, left turn onto the Seawall bike path. At the Vancouver Rowing Club, veer left off of the Seawall, into the parking lot and onto Stanley Park Drive.

Continue counterclockwise on Stanley Park Drive (roadway closed to vehicles) until Pipeline Road Extension, then turn right onto the pathway leading down to the Stanley Park Seawall pedestrian path.

Return clockwise along the Seawall. Proceed back through the Chilco Underpass and follow the Chilco pedestrian path beside Lost Lagoon. This section of the race may have runners going both directions. Please yield to oncoming runners on their return leg.

Emerging from the tunnel, right turn onto the bike path through Ceperley Park, then follow the pedestrian path around the east side of Second Beach Concession. Left turn, circling Second Beach Pool counterclockwise, and follow the pedestrian Seawall path back along English Bay toward the Aquatic Centre.

Upon reaching the Aquatic Centre, left turn onto the Seaside bike path and follow the Service Road behind the Aquatic Centre to Beach Avenue. Right turn eastbound on Beach Avenue bike lanes, then left turn climb onto Granville Street under the Bridge. The final stretch takes runners right onto Pacific Boulevard’s westbound curb lane before a hard right turn onto Drake Street and the Finish between Pacific Boulevard and Roundhouse Mews.

Most runners will be on the seawall from 9am to 10:30am.
